LifeLabs is hiring a
HomeCare Coordinator
at our
Mississauga, ON
branch. Our
Homecare Coordinators
are responsible for creating and scheduling work orders daily for Mobile Laboratory Patient Technicians (MLPTs) demonstrating LifeLabs' Vision and Values in all Activities.

Operational
Key Responsibilities:

  • Schedule work orders for MLPTs and book according to area/prioritize work order for MLPTs for efficiency and route optimization.
  • Coordinate and review MLPT routes.
  • Develop and maintain effective communication with clients, team members and support staff including practicing effective listening skills.
  • Ensure effective communication using various modes of communication-for example, with MLPTs on the road to add on visits, to communicate systems failure/halt in work to internal and external clients.
  • Distribute written/verbal communications to MLPTs, as required.
  • Ongoing communication with manager regarding difficulties/trends happening in the field.
  • Receive inbound calls, answer patient or client questions, direct callers for out-of-scope work.
  • Deal with customer service issues/problem solving.
  • Reschedule patients for missed appointments.
  • Update orders and communicate with Ontario Health at Home (LHIN clients) on a daily basis, working with in HPG system.
  • Accurate data entry of all service requests into work orders.
  • Prepare and process requisitions/reports.
  • Interpret lab requests for clients and professional services.
  • Put together reports in standard order, working to a deadline.
  • Handle fax requests.
